What Title Insurance Covers
Hidden Title Defects
Title insurance in Fenton covers hidden defects not seen in standard title searches. These include undisclosed liens or claims by unknown heirs. Sonic Title's thorough search process finds these potential problems, but insurance adds extra protection if issues arise after closing. This is important in Fenton, where properties may have been passed down through generations, leading to possible oversights in records.
Forgery and Fraud
Forgery and fraud are unfortunate realities in real estate. Title insurance protects against forged signatures on deeds or fraudulent ownership claims. What Title Insurance Does Not Cover
Known Defects and Zoning Issues
Title insurance doesn't cover known defects or zoning issues found before the policy is issued. For example, if a title search shows an existing easement, it won't be covered. Sonic Title ensures all known issues are disclosed and addressed before closing, preventing surprises later. Zoning changes or disputes with local authorities over land use fall outside title insurance, needing separate legal advice.
Post-Policy Events
Title insurance protects against past events, not future ones. Issues after the policy date, like new liens or property disputes, aren't covered.
